Street artists in Midwood, Brooklyn, created this stunning “Gratitude” mural to honor Adam “MCA” Yauch, who passed away last week at the age of 47.

Adam Horovitz posted these words on the Beastie Boys blog: “As you can imagine, shit is just fkd up right now. But I wanna say thank you to all our friends and family (which are kinda one in the same) for all the love and support. I’m glad to know that all the love that Yauch has put out into the world is coming right back at him.” Man, that picture is really sweet. “PWR 2 MCA. I ♥ U.”

From the Comedy Awards: It was the Weekend Update reunion that wasn’t. Colin Quinn, Chevy Chase, and Norm Macdonald sat behind the desk together in a bit that ended up getting cut from the TV airing of the Comedy Awards.

When there’s a television show as heavily anticipated, written about, reviewed and examined as ‘Girls’, the HBO series by Lena Dunham that premiered April 15, it’s no surprise everyone has something to say about it. I’ll jump on the bandwagon to respond to critics and viewers who expected ‘Girls’ to represent anything other than its own characters. Of course it doesn’t. ‘Girls’ shouldn’t tell your story.
